4 Subject: [PATCH] dpaa2-eth: Avoid unbounded while loops
5
6 Throughout the driver there are several places where we wait
7 indefinitely for DPIO portal commands to be executed, while
8 the portal returns a busy response code.
9
10 Even though in theory we are guaranteed the portals become
11 available eventually, in practice the QBMan hardware module
12 may become unresponsive in various corner cases.
13
14 Make sure we can never get stuck in an infinite while loop
15 by adding a retry counter for all portal commands.

149
150 +/* Number of times to retry DPIO portal operations while waiting
151 + * for portal to finish executing current command and become
152 + * available. We want to avoid being stuck in a while loop in case
153 + * hardware becomes unresponsive, but not give up too easily if
154 + * the portal really is busy for valid reasons
155 + */
156 +#define DPAA2_ETH_SWP_BUSY_RETRIES 1000
